Top Forex Brokers Overview

Broker NameRegulationMinimum DepositPlatformsKey Features
IG GroupFCA, ASIC, CFTC$0Proprietary, MT4Spread betting, wide market access
PepperstoneFCA, ASIC, CySEC$200MT4, MT5, cTraderECN pricing, fast execution
IC MarketsASIC, CySEC$200MT4, MT5, cTraderRaw spreads, deep liquidity
Forex.comCFTC, NFA, FCA$50MT4, ProprietaryBroad product range
OANDACFTC, NFA, FCANo minimumProprietary, MT4Transparent pricing
XMASIC, CySEC, IFSC$5MT4, MT5Bonuses, multiple accounts
FXTM (ForexTime)FCA, CySEC, FSCA$10MT4, MT5Copy trading, regional support
HotForex (HFM)FCA, CySEC, FSCA$5MT4, MT5Micro accounts, bonuses
RoboForexIFSC$10MT4, MT5, cTraderSocial trading, automation
Saxo BankFCA, MAS, FSA$10,000SaxoTraderGO, PROInstitutional-grade tools

How to Use This List

  • Prioritize brokers regulated by reputable authorities, as often noted in Forex Brokers Lists.
  • Consider minimum deposit according to your budget.
  • Choose platforms compatible with your trading style.
  • Evaluate fees and commissions for overall cost.
  • Look for brokers with solid customer support.

Key Takeaways

  • Regulation is critical for safety and reliability.
  • MetaTrader 4 and 5 remain the most popular platforms.
  • Some brokers offer low minimum deposits suitable for beginners.
  • High liquidity brokers offer tighter spreads and better execution.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which forex broker is best for beginners?

Brokers like XM and HotForex offer low minimum deposits and educational resources, which can often be found on a comprehensive Forex Brokers List.

Are all brokers regulated?

No, only brokers licensed by financial authorities are regulated.

Can I trade with no minimum deposit?

Some brokers allow deposits as low as $1, but many require higher minimums.

How do I verify broker regulation?

Check the regulator’s official website for the broker’s license.

What platforms do these brokers support?

Most support MetaTrader 4 and 5, with some offering proprietary platforms as listed in Forex Brokers Lists.
